I want to migrate Jira Service desk from data center to Existing Cloud Instance. I'm trying through Jira Cloud migration assistant.In middle I got response that It will not migrate Jira service desk projects only software projects are appearing.

At this point, JCMA as we call it doesn't have the capability to migrate Jira Service Management projects, we are working hard to make the Assistant capable of migrating Jira Service Management projects to Cloud.

We are tracking our progress through the following feature request, make sure to watch it to get any updates.

 

- Support migration of Jira Service Desk projects 

 

In our Cloud Roadmap, you can see the following entry.

 

Cloud Roadmap 

 

Jira Service Management migration

Jira Service Management

Use the Jira Cloud Migration Assistant to migrate Jira Service Management projects to cloud. Service Desk projects can currently be migrated using Jira site import.

Q2 2021

 

If your Cloud site already has data in it, site import will not be an option, since it overrides the existing data and replaces it with the backup coming.

 

You might try to test migrating the issues alone using the JSON importer, the JSON importer would be better than using CSV since the issue history is critical for SLA calculations.

Even if you have only JSW projects, a site import replaces the data with the backup you are importing, we don't recommend doing it if you want to keep these projects.

 

In this case, you are correct in your previous comment, there are only these two options CSV or JSON.
